Materials and Building and construction



When comparing Invisalign to standard dental braces, the materials and building differ dramatically. Invisalign consists of clear, smooth plastic aligners custom-made to fit your teeth. These aligners are virtually undetectable, making them a prominent option for those looking for a more discreet orthodontic therapy.

On the other hand, standard braces involve metal braces that are glued to your teeth. These brackets are then connected by cords and rubber bands, using pressure to gradually move your teeth right into the preferred position.

The building of Invisalign aligners enables a much more comfortable fit compared to conventional braces. The smooth plastic product decreases inflammation to your cheeks and gum tissues, which is a common concern with metal braces and wires. Additionally, Invisalign aligners are removable, making it simpler to clean and floss your teeth with no blockages.

In contrast, traditional braces are repaired onto your teeth, needing additional treatment and time for correct maintenance.

Maintenance and Oral Health



The upkeep and oral health methods vary in between Invisalign and typical dental braces due to their distinct design and building and construction.

With Invisalign, you can get rid of the aligners when consuming or cleaning your teeth, allowing you to maintain your normal oral hygiene routine without any obstructions. It's crucial to comb your teeth after consuming prior to putting the aligners back on to avoid food bits from obtaining entraped and creating degeneration.

On Look At This , standard braces need extra focus to keep your teeth clean. Food bits can easily get stuck in the brackets and cables, resulting in plaque accumulation and potential dental caries. You'll require to make use of unique tools like interdental brushes or floss threaders to clean in between the cables and braces successfully.

Presence and Aesthetics



Exposure and aesthetic appeals play a significant role in the comparison in between Invisalign and traditional braces. When it pertains to appearance, Invisalign supplies a clear advantage over conventional dental braces. Invisalign aligners are basically invisible, making them a preferred choice for those who prefer a more very discreet orthodontic treatment choice.



Unlike the recognizable metal brackets and cords of traditional dental braces, Invisalign aligners are transparent and assimilate with your natural teeth, allowing you to smile with confidence throughout your treatment.

Conventional braces, on the other hand, are much more obvious due to their steel parts.
